DrupalCafeLutsk 31 Scheduled for 28 May with AI and Drupal-Focused Sessions
DrupalCafeLutsk 31 is scheduled for 28 May at 19:00 EET at the DevBranch office in Lutsk, Ukraine, with organisers offering both free in-person attendance and online participation through YouTube.
The latest edition of the Drupal community meetup series will feature three presentations focused on artificial intelligence workflows, Apple ecosystem technologies, and team collaboration in AI-driven environments.
Oleh Kulakevych of REDWING STUDIO will present a session titled “Apple Ecosystem (2011–2026),” described as the sixth and final talk in the series. The presentation will focus on Apple TV, Vision Pro, and the development of Apple-focused education initiatives and mobile development lectures in Lutsk and Ukraine.
Artem Sylchuk of DevBranch will deliver a presentation titled “Vibe Coding with Claude Code,” examining AI-assisted development workflows in 2026. Topics scheduled for discussion include context memory handling, plugin ecosystems, MCP servers, coding workflows for Drupal projects, pricing considerations, and critiques of heavily promoted AI development approaches.
Olha Sozonik of AnyforSoft will present “Tech for Good: The World We’re Shaping with AI,” based on discussions connected to the World Happiness Summit. The session will address AI and human interaction within teams, leadership challenges in AI-assisted workplaces, and digital hygiene practices.
The event continues the ongoing DrupalCafeLutsk meetup series organised for Drupal professionals, developers, and technology community members in Ukraine. Organisers encouraged attendees to participate either onsite in Lutsk or remotely through the event’s YouTube broadcast..
